What is BitTorrent:
Bit Torrent, a peer-to-peer file-sharing protocol, was created by Bram Cohen in 2001. This decentralized technology allows users to distribute data across the internet efficiently. The primary goal of BitTorrent is to enable users to share large files quickly by dividing them into smaller parts called 'torrents'. These torrents are then distributed among users, allowing for faster downloads as multiple sources can contribute to the file transfer.

Peer-to-Peer File Sharing
Peer-to-peer file sharing lies at the heart of Bit Torrent's functionality. This decentralized approach allows users to directly connect with one another to share and distribute files without relying on a central server. Through peer-to-peer file sharing, individuals can not only download files but also contribute by seeding, enhancing the overall efficiency and speed of the BitTorrent network.
Decentralized Networks
At the crux of Bit Torrent technology is its decentralized network structure. How BitTorrent works is by breaking down large files into smaller packets, which are then distributed among a network of peers. The importance of seeders and leechers cannot be understated, as seeders provide complete files for download and leechers download these files. This symbiotic relationship ensures a balance within the network, optimizing download speeds and availability of files.
How BitTorrent Works
The unique aspect of how Bit Torrent operates lies in its ability to distribute file chunks simultaneously among multiple users. This parallel sharing mechanism results in faster downloads as users receive different parts of a file from various sources. By leveraging this distributed approach, BitTorrent minimizes the strain on individual servers while maximizing download speeds for users.
Importance of Seeders and Leechers
Seeders play a pivotal role in the Bit Torrent ecosystem by making complete files available for download. On the other hand, leechers contribute to the network by downloading files and sharing them with other peers. The presence of a healthy ratio of seeders to leechers ensures a robust network where files remain accessible and download speeds remain optimal.
Torrent Files


Torrent files serve as the gateway to content available on the Bit Torrent network. These small files contain information about the files being shared, including their names, sizes, and unique identifiers. By downloading a torrent file, users can initiate the process of connecting to the decentralized network and accessing the desired content, whether it be software, media, or other digital files.
Benefits of Using Bit
Torrent
Bit Torrent offers several key advantages that set it apart from traditional file-sharing methods. One of the most prominent benefits is its ability to deliver high download speeds, allowing users to obtain files quickly and efficiently. By leveraging the collective bandwidth of multiple peers, BitTorrent can significantly reduce download times compared to centralized servers. This feature is particularly advantageous for users who need to access large files or data sets promptly.
In addition to speed, Bit Torrent is known for its exceptional bandwidth efficiency. Traditional downloading methods often strain servers and networks, leading to slow speeds for users. In contrast, BitTorrent minimizes the strain on any single source by distributing the load across multiple peers. This not only enhances the download experience for users but also reduces the overall demand on external servers.
Furthermore, Bit Torrent offers unmatched reliability and resilience in file sharing. Since files are distributed across numerous peers, the likelihood of total data loss is significantly decreased. Even if one or more sources go offline during a download, other peers in the network can continue sharing the file. This decentralized nature ensures that BitTorrent remains functional and accessible, even under adverse conditions like network disruptions or server failures. As a result, users can enjoy a more stable and consistent downloading experience, free from the risks of single-point failures.

DMCA Notices
DMCA notices act as warnings for users engaged in copyright infringement via Bit Torrent. When a copyright holder detects their content being shared unlawfully on the network, they can issue a DMCA notice. These notices notify the internet service provider (ISP) of the infringing activity, prompting the ISP to take action, which may include forwarding the notice to the user and potentially taking down the copyrighted material. Receiving a DMCA notice should serve as a cautionary signal for users to evaluate their online activities and refrain from sharing copyrighted material without proper authorization.

In the realm of Bit Torrent, there exist several common misconceptions that often lead to misunderstanding and misinformation among users. Addressing these fallacies is crucial in dispelling myths and ensuring a clear grasp of the technology. One prevalent misconception is that BitTorrent is inherently illegal or synonymous with piracy. While it is true that some users leverage BitTorrent for unauthorized sharing of copyrighted material, it is essential to recognize that BitTorrent, as a protocol, is neutral and can be used for legitimate purposes. Understanding this distinction is vital in avoiding stereotyping and appreciating the versatility of BitTorrent as a file-sharing tool.
Another common myth surrounding Bit Torrent is the belief that it is inherently unsafe and exposes users to various risks such as malware or privacy breaches. While it is true that the decentralized nature of BitTorrent networks may pose some security challenges, taking appropriate precautions can mitigate these concerns effectively. By downloading content only from reputable sources, verifying file integrity through checksums, and utilizing virtual private networks (VPNs) for added encryption, users can enhance their security posture while engaging with BitTorrent. Education and awareness about safe practices play a significant role in safeguarding against potential threats in the BitTorrent ecosystem.
Furthermore, there is a misconception that Bit Torrent is exclusively used for large-scale file sharing or distributing pirated content. While BitTorrent undeniably facilitates efficient sharing of large files, it is also instrumental in disseminating legal content, open-source software, and other legitimate data. Recognizing the diverse applications of BitTorrent beyond illicit activities is paramount in fostering a balanced perspective on its utility and value in the digital landscape. By appreciating the nuances of BitTorrent's capabilities, users can harness its potential for both personal and professional use while adhering to legal and ethical boundaries.
Lastly, it is often assumed that Bit Torrent inherently leads to slower download speeds or poor connection stability compared to traditional centralized downloading methods. In reality, BitTorrent's peer-to-peer architecture is designed to leverage collective resources from seeders and leechers, resulting in faster download speeds as more users participate in file sharing. The fluid nature of BitTorrent networks allows for dynamic adjustments based on seed availability, enhancing resilience and reliability in data transfers. Understanding the mechanics of BitTorrent networks can help users optimize their download experiences and appreciate the efficiency gains offered by this decentralized approach.
